WebDec 6, 2024 · For this test, you collect a stool sample at home and send it to a laboratory for testing. Stool DNA testing is typically repeated every three years. The pros: The test doesn't require bowel preparation, sedation or insertion of a scope. You can eat and drink normally, and take your normal medications, before the test. WebSep 14, 2024 · Close the toilet seat on the collection hat. This will hold the collection hat in place. Sit on the toilet to have a bowel movement (poop) as usual. Don’t pee on your stool or in the collection hat. Using the wooden stick, place 2 to 3 small scoopfuls of stool into each specimen cup (s). Place the specimen cup (s) inside the plastic biohazard ...
